Ha sete di te, Signore, l’anima mia (stile cubista) senza scritta
A stylized portrait painting in a cubist-inspired style depicts a person from the chest up, with their head tilted slightly and eyes looking upwards with a pained or hopeful expression. Their hands are clasped together in a praying gesture at the bottom center of the frame. The figure's skin is rendered in shades of light blue, brown, and grey, with sharp, geometric planes defining the facial features, hands, and body. The background features a cool-toned abstract composition of intersecting lines and triangular and quadrilateral shapes in shades of grey, white, and light blue, suggesting a fragmented and angular space. Two Gothic-style stained-glass windows, with arched tops and colorful patterns in blue, yellow, and red hues, are visible in the upper corners of the background like ethereal visions. The overall artwork has an emotional, spiritual, and introspective quality, with a dramatic use of geometric forms and contrasting cool and warm color palettes.
